Skylights, while a valuable enhancement to any type of home, can present numerous issues that may jeopardize their performance and the total honesty of a home. Usual issues consist of leakages, which frequently result from bad installment or aging seals, causing water damage and mold and mildew development (Skylight Repair). Splits in the skylight material can happen as a result of severe temperature level fluctuations or influences, lessening power performance and permitting drafts. In addition, condensation buildup inside skylights can suggest insufficient air flow, promoting an environment for mold and mildew. If left unaddressed, these issues not only impact the skylight's efficiency but can likewise lead to more comprehensive architectural damages. Homeowners might additionally observe minimized natural light as dirt and debris gather on the glass, decreasing the skylight's intended purpose. Timely acknowledgment and repair of these common skylight problems are necessary to protect both the visual and functional high qualities of a homeThe Duty of Routine Upkeep in Skylight Performance

When house owners observe adjustments in their skylights, it might indicate the demand for fixings. Usual indications consist of leakages or water stains on the ceiling or walls bordering the skylight, which suggest endangered seals or damaged flashing. In addition, noticeable fractures or cracks in the skylight glass can cause additional damage and power loss. Home owners must also look out to condensation build-up between glass layers, suggesting a failed seal. Discoloration or warping of the skylight frame might recommend extended exposure to dampness, bring about potential architectural concerns. A breezy environment near the skylight can also signify insufficient insulation or sealing. Lastly, if the skylight is hard to open up or close, it may call for adjustment or fixing to work properly. Recognizing these indications early can stop a lot more substantial damages and guarantee the skylight remains to improve the home's natural lighting and aesthetic allure.Economical Solutions for Skylight Maintenance
